The derived block functionality continues to gain significant adoption across an array of clients across asset managers, sovereign wealth funds, pension funds and hedge funds. Year to date, we've seen over $22.5B notional traded in derived blocks on Sector futures ($17.5B notional) and the new futures ($5.5B) brought into scope for the derived block eligibility expansion .
